Petros Haris (1902-1998). Petros Haris, whose real name was Ioannis Marmariadis, was born in Athens, the son of Nikolaos Marmariadis from Crete. He completed his high school education in Athens and then enrolled in the Law School of the University, graduating in 1924. Immediately after, he began collaborating with Athenian newspapers and the magazine Noumas as an editor and literary associate. He worked at the School of Fine Arts (as Secretary and later General Secretary with the rank of General Secretary of the Ministry) until he retired in 1964 with the title of Honorary General Secretary. In 1933, he took over the direction of the magazine Nea Estia (after the departure of Grigorios Xenopoulos) and remained in that position until 1987. Under his leadership, Nea Estia was awarded the Academy of Athens Prize in 1946. He received the First State Prize for Travel Literature for his work "Cities and Seas," the Order of George I, the Golden Cross of the Athonite Millennium, and the Holy Cross of the Apostle and Evangelist Mark. He served as a member of the Board of Directors of the National Theatre, a member of the judging committee for the State Literary and Theatre Awards and the Parnassos Theatre Awards, a member of the Group of Twelve, the National Society of Greek Writers, the Kostas and Eleni Ouranis Foundation, the Union of Greek Theatre and Music Critics, and President of the Class of Letters and Fine Arts (1973). He was a member of the Academy of Athens and was elected its president in 1977. He first appeared in the field of narrative literature in the pages of the magazine "The Children's Formation" under the pseudonym "Blue and White Banner." His publications followed in Noumas, and in 1924, his first collection of short stories, "The Last Night of the Earth," was published. His early works are part of the Symbolist movement, as expressed in Greece mainly through Konstantinos Chatzopoulos. His writing is characterized by an essayistic style, subdued tones, and meticulous form. The literary genre he primarily cultivated was the short story, but he also wrote travel texts and two novels, "Days of Wrath" (1979) and "The Tornado" (1992).
